#184d76 - RGB(24, 77, 118) - Midnight Blue Color FAQ
Hex color code for Midnight Blue color is #184d76. RGB color code for midnight blue color is rgb(24, 77, 118).
The RGB value corresponding to the hexadecimal color code #184d76 is rgb(24, 77, 118). These values represent the intensities of the red, green, and blue components of the color, respectively. Here, '24' indicates the intensity of the red component, '77' represents the green component's intensity, and '118' denotes the blue component's intensity. Combined in these specific proportions, these three color components create the color represented by #184d76.

The RGB color 24, 77, 118 represents a dull and muted shade of Blue. The websafe version of this color is hex 006666. This color might be commonly referred to as a shade similar to Midnight Blue.
In the CMYK (Cyan, Magenta, Yellow, Black) color model, the color represented by the hexadecimal code #184d76 is composed of 80% Cyan, 35% Magenta, 0% Yellow, and 54% Black. In this CMYK breakdown, the Cyan component at 80% influences the coolness or green-blue aspects of the color, whereas the 35% of Magenta contributes to the red-purple qualities. The 0% of Yellow typically adds to the brightness and warmth, and the 54% of Black determines the depth and overall darkness of the shade. The resulting color can range from bright and vivid to deep and muted, depending on these CMYK values. The CMYK color model is crucial in color printing and graphic design, offering a practical way to mix these four ink colors to create a vast spectrum of hues.
